Feelings Flash Cards Todd Parr makes understanding feelings fun with these 20 sturdy flash cards featuring 40 different emotions. Each card shows two opposite feelings, one on each side, rendered in words and lively pictures. Kids will learn what it means to feel silly and serious, calm and nervous, brave and scared, and more.Product Measures: 5.25 x 7 x 1.75Recommended Ages: 3 months - 4 years
